Goodhue County plans tornado drills

Apr 15, 2020
Goodhue County is participating in the statewide tornado drills on Thursday, April 16 (today) at 1:45 p.m. and 6:45 p.m. Dispatchers will activate sirens.  Families should practice their emergency plan for tornados and go to their shelter for such an event, the county said in a news release.
